Hadi Jakmora, a Business student at Trent University, came up with an idea to build a software mobile application where users can post tasks they need help with and others can get paid to provide those services. To make his dream a reality, he began building connections and going out in public until he finally launched Quest It.
The Innovation Cluster is currently with Quest It and its CEO, Hadi, to help them reach their business goals and improve their digital platform.
Founded by Jessica Dalliday, Pilates on Demand is an online Pilates, Yoga, Barre, and Meditation class platform designed for real people with real bodies. When Jessica suddenly passed away in 2021, her husband Mike Dalliday took over the business. Both Jessica and Mike were first-time entrepreneurs and discovered there were many key concepts and strategies they needed to learn. Through the one-on-one mentorship and support provided at the Innovation Cluster, they gained specific knowledge and tips to make Pilates on Demand a success.
Horizon Aircraft became a client of the Innovation Cluster in 2019. They came to the Innovation Cluster’s Startup Incubator program with huge strength in engineering and design, but lacked a deep network and a coherent business strategy to tell their story, attract investors, and bring Horizon to the next level. Through knowledge gained, connections made, and the 1-on-1 mentorship they received, Horizon was able to navigate several complex business deals and land over $3 million in investment to build a complete prototype of their aircraft by the time they graduated in 2021.
“The Innovation Cluster’s leadership has deep experience from operating and growing startups right up to experience with sophisticated public companies. They provided us with solid strategic advice and connected us with the right people. It is one of the reasons we got to where we are now.”

Water Canada Magazine rated Peterborough the #2 city in Canada and #1 in Ontario to launch a water technology startup thanks to our more than 250 surrounding lakes and rivers, entrepreneurial ecosystem, and H2O Makerspace which provides access to over 30 pieces of sophisticated water testing equipment!

Agtech at the Innovation Cluster
Our region has a strong agricultural presence. The Kawartha Lakes has over 300,000 acres used for farming, more than 1,200 farms, and an estimated 8,000+ people employed year-round.*
The Innovation Cluster’s focus on agtech makes it a leading destination for entrepreneurs in this field. Thanks to the support and resources we provide, agtech startups in Peterborough and the Kawarthas are able to thrive and make a significant impact in the agricultural industry.
*City of Kawartha Lakes 2016 Census of Agriculture
